首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>xcode:创建带有按钮的可缩放图像

xcode:创建带有按钮的可缩放图像
EN

Stack Overflow用户
提问于 2011-01-01 13:20:27
回答 1查看 1.2K关注 0票数 1

大家好,首先祝大家新年快乐!我对堆栈溢出很陌生,但我经常用它来回答我的问题。但现在我站在墙上却不知道要往前走。

我想做的是: xcode - iPad项目

  1. 应用程序有一张非常大的图片(4000 up到5000 up),
  2. 应用程序应该从缩小图片开始,以查看整个图像,
  3. 图片应该是可缩放的,如果图片被放大,则应该有几个按钮或可选择的区域(不可见按钮)来显示文本字段(弹出)。这些按钮也应该在图像上放大。所以

一张脸的照片

  • 脸放大,所以眼睛填充整个显示器
  • 用户触摸眉毛
  • 弹出一张表“眉毛保护眼睛不受灰尘”

显示

第1点和第2点(和第3点)我在本网站的教程中设置了http://vimeo.com/1642150

EN

回答 1

Stack Overflow用户

发布于 2011-01-02 17:35:18

您需要连接UIScrollView的委托方法。

代码语言:javascript
复制
- (void)scrollViewDidZoom:(UIScrollView *)scrollView
{
   if (scrollView.zoomScale > EXTRA_INFO_THRESHOLD)
   {
      [self displayExtraInfoLayer];
   }
   else
   {
      [self hideExtraInfoLayer];
   }
}

您可以将这些按钮转储到UIView容器中,并将其添加到滚动视图上方的displayExtraInfoLayer视图中。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/4574166

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档